Lazada warehouse

Malaysia / Selangor / Shah Alam / Jalan Subang 7, 2611 & 2612
 office building, warehouse
 Upload a photo

mymydin warehouse, Lot PT 2611 & 2612, Taman Perindustrian Subang, Jalan Subang 7, USJ 19
Nearby cities:
Coordinates:   3°1'58"N   101°35'47"E
This article was last modified 9 years ago